Characteristics
A small / medium sized tree
Many varieties are found
Cultivated all over plains of India
Propagation by seeds
PPRC/INDIA 02
Not affected by serious disease
Valued for tender pods utilized as vegetable
All parts of medicinal value
Many active chemicals for curing different
diseases
